Spoke to a board member last season and asked about this as a short time before I had been at Fir Park where there were no police inside the ground. I was told that they would like to do this at McDiarmid Park, but there seems to be some reluctance on the part of Tayside's finest to go along with this. I think that this is a shame as it could save the club some money and I feel that they are not needed at most games in Perth.

This is not good Imho. and is not my experience of Pitoddrie as others will confirm . One particular steward there refused to let us go down a set of steps near the kiosk to get to empty seats.

Same after the game started he would not allow you to use the steps to go up to the kiosk or toilet.

Using other steps meant disturbing those who were seated.

This caused great ill feeling to our support who could see empty seats feet away but had to make a big detour to get there.

It wasn't till into the 2nd half after great arguments that a 2nd steward appeared and access was allowed . There It is a high partition fence and barrier segregating the fans at these steps which had stewards .

The reason given was "These steps are STERILE"

You can imagine the laughter and anger this caused.

Get it sorted Aberdeen.
